Private image; create criminal offense for creation, recording or alteration of without consent of depicted individual.
(H) Died In Committee
Summary
The bill would make it illegal to produce, record, change or distribute photos or videos that show a person's intimate parts or sexual activity without their consent, including images that have been edited or fabricated. It targets anyone who does this with intent to harm the depicted person, while shielding internet service providers and technology developers from liability. First‑time offenders face misdemeanor penalties; repeat or profit‑motivated offenses become felonies.
